Medium body, vibrant crimson mauve purple colour with mauve purple hue. Perfumed nose with top note of fresh raspberry, violets, liquorice and spice. Mouthfilling palate – with generous flavours of raspberry, plum and spice over a cherry background. Fine grained tannins. Long aftertaste of vanilla, raspberry, cherry and spice.

The 2006 Wallace, tasted from a barrel sample, is a 70% Shiraz, 30% Grenache blend with an identical oak treatment. The 2006 is more structured than the 2005 but they could otherwise pass as identical twins.
91-94 Points Jay Miller - Wine Advocate #173 Oct 2007
